I keep kids dvd's in cases so they can easily see titles and covers, with backups on spindles.
My own I keep in nifty leather binders which hold one dvd and full cover per page. I get those for $3 for binders that hold 20. a couple hundred dvd's take less room than 30 in cases. and they are easy to flip through. -
